Access to justice? Evaluating workers’ experience in the Employment Tribunals (ETs) in Britain: The employment professionals’ perspective pre- and post-pandemic

conference contribution
posted on 2024-09-19, 10:04 authored by Katerina Sidiropoulou

This study examines the operation of Employment Tribunals in Britain pre- and post-pandemic. The overarching hypothesis is that the experience is a negative and disempowering for the majority of workers. A selection of senior experts with great experience of Employment Tribunals was interviewed at a time when significant legislative changes to Employment Tribunals’ operation were passed after 2012 and the study continues exploring the same issues after the pandemic.
